Palo Alto Networks Idira: Democratizing Privilege Control, AI Agent Identity as New Control Plane
Palo Alto Networks launches Idira, an identity security platform built on CyberArk PAM, extending privileged access control to every human, machine, and AI agent identity. Core features include Zero Standing Privilege (ZSP), JIT permissions, and an AI engine for automatically discovering hidden entitlements and recommending least privilege. Idira becomes PANW's third core platform alongside Strata and Cortex.

Cisco Launches Open-Source AI Agent Security Solution DefenseClaw
Cisco released open-source security solution DefenseClaw with four protection engines for OpenClaw AI Agent, covering prompt inspection, tool detection, installation scanning and code review. The solution demonstrates defense against 11.9% identified threats including malicious skills and unsafe MCP servers through hands-on labs.
